EC3 652 Rack Controller and ECD 000 Display Unit EMERSON Operating Instructions Note This document contains short form instructions for experienced users Use last column in List of Parameters to document your individual settlings More detailed information can be found in the User Manual ee ee 6 4 6 6 pee lee TrTt pS z i T or r ed et f j kasja sjes ee The EC3 652 rack controller is a digital controller for racks in commercial refrigeration applications for controlling up to 8 compressors with conventional on off step control working on a common suction line Alternatively the controller may be configured to control a Copeland Digital Scroll compressor and up to 7 single stage compressors The control target is to maintain the suction pressure at a defined value by varying the available compressor capacity Network ECD 000 EC3 65x For the measurement of the common suction pressure and the optional discharge pressure two PT4 pressure sensors 2 3 with 4 20mA interface can be connected to the controller The rack controller has eight relay outputs to command the compressors 9 Eight digital inputs for 24V AC DC or 230V AC are available for the compressor serial alarms 4 plus one for low pressure alarm 5 one for high pressure alarm 6 one for oil level alarm 7 and one for refrigerant level alarm 8 To control the discharge end temperature of the Digital Scroll compressor a temper

8. bH amp Co OHG is not to be held responsible for erroneous literature regarding capacities dimensions applications etc stated herein Products specifications and data in this literature are subject to change without notice The information given herein is based on technical data and tests which ALCO CONTROLS believes to be reliable and which are in compliance with Visualising Data WebPages A TCP IP Controller Readme file is available on the www emersonclimate eu website to provide detailed information about TCP IP Ethernet connectivity Please refer to this file if you need information beyond the contents of this instruction sheet The EC3 652 has a TCP IP Ethernet communication interface enabling the controller to be directly connected to a PC or network via the standard Ethernet port The EC3 652 controller has embedded WebPages to enable the user to easily visualise the parameter lists using real text labels No special software or hardware is required Connect the EC3 652 using the optional ECX N60 cable assembly to a network or hub that enables the controller to receive a dynamic TCP IP address If a DHCP server is not available the controller can be connected to a computer using a crossover cable plugged directly into the Ethernet port In this case the TCP IP address of the computer must be manually modified to be compatible with the default address of the controller Refer to the TCP IP Controller Readme file for more details Ope
